Output bcc83106ad7aa184404042f96eb9741f588f8858c1a35686bdd94b50fcea669c:0

value
39409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58686a7e420ed3fca2643981bd163b8a2c6282fa OP_EQUAL
address
39kUUNhYSYSRs6RPa7nvUAaVvotfSPQZy9
transaction
bcc83106ad7aa184404042f96eb9741f588f8858c1a35686bdd94b50fcea669c
confirmations
234617
spent
true